From its foundation in 1919, the Royale Union Saint-Gilloise football club played its matches and trained on an open-air pitch in the Duden Park. In 1921, it decided to build an enclosed stadium for its increasing number of spectators. A design by the architect Albert Callewaert for a stadium with a capacity of 35,000 was accepted in 1922. The imposing main façade, of artificial white stone and red bricks, with white stone decorations, was built in a mere four months. The main stand seats 2,500 spectators and is covered with a rivetted metal roof. Under the stand there are changing rooms and showers and a café and members' room with its original Art Deco stained-glass window in the club's colours.

Arch. Albert CALLEWAERT, 1926
